      What You Need to Know

      Nordstrom was started in Seattle, WA, a city that is generally considered progressive, containing a large LGBTQIA+ community. The company culture very much mirrors the culture of the city and surrounding area. As they state online, "Nordstrom is a better place when our employees can bring their whole selves to work, and a diverse workforce creates a better environment for everyone. We support and celebrate all of our employees, including members and allies of the LGBTQIA+ community."

      How to Answer

      Your interviewer is aiming to assess your level of cultural competence, and how well you work with those who have perspectives and approaches to their work differing from your own. Share your experience with working in diverse and inclusive environments, how this aligns with your values, and how it motivates your work and sense of teamwork and collaboration.
